Accompanied by three letters from Eberhard Alsen, of the State University of New York at Cortland, one to Salinger on the influence of his work, and two to Swami Adiswarananda. These letters were accompanied by photocopies of two articles by Alsen ("The Role of Vedanta Hinduism in Salinger's Seymour Novel" [Renascence, vol. XXXIII, no. 2, Winter 1981] and "'Light-winged Smoke': Thoreau's Apology for His Poetry" [ESQ, vol. 26, 4th Quarter 1980]), both inscribed to Swami Adiswarananda, which have been removed to the collection files.
Acquired with a collection of clippings from the New York Times, Time, and People magazine related to J. D. Salinger, dated 1988-2011. See collection files.
Collection consists of 28 letters from Salinger to Swami Nikhilananda (3), Swami Adiswarananda (2), the Ramakrishna-Vivekananda Center (23); 12 letters to Salinger from Swami Adiswarananda (7), Dorothy Kruger (1), Priscilla Carden (3), and Swami Vidananda [Barry Zelikovsky] (1); 2 letters from Swami Vidananda [Barry Zelikovsky] to Colleen Salinger; and 2 cards from Colleen Salinger to Swami Vidananda. Correspondence is accompanied by seven envelopes addressed to the Center and three copies of checks issued by J. D. Salinger to the Center. Many letters record donations sent by Salinger to the Center. Letters in the collection have been cataloged individually; see related records for more information.
